Marion was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They came up short against the Richlands Blue Tornado, falling 4-1. Things were pretty much settled by the half as Marion were already down 4-0.
Marion now has a losing record of 4-5. As for Richlands,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 3-7.
Coming up, Marion will venture away from home to square off against Virginia High at 4:00 p.m. on Thursday. Virginia High will roll in looking for their fourth straight victory, something Marion surely won't give up without a fight. As for Richlands, they will welcome Lebanon at 5:30 p.m. on Thursday.
